Incorrect Paint Color Selection



Picking the right paint color is important when it pertains to attaining the preferred search for your space. It establishes the mood, enhances the atmosphere, and ties the room together. The wrong color selection can cause a space that feels unbalanced or clashes with the remainder of your decor.

Before choosing a color, take into consideration the natural lighting in the room, the purpose of the room, and the existing colors of your furniture and accessories.

To prevent the mistake of selecting the wrong paint shade, start by testing out examples on your wall surfaces. Paint can look various in various lights problems, so it's vital to see exactly how the shade appears throughout various times of the day. In addition, don't forget to think about the touches of the paint shade.

Warm undertones can develop a cozy ambience, while amazing undertones can make a room really feel more roomy and airy.

Inadequate Surface Prep Work



Poor surface area preparation prior to painting can significantly affect the outcome of your project. Avoiding or hurrying via this essential action can lead to numerous concerns such as bad paint adhesion, unequal appearance, and early peeling or breaking. To make certain an effective paint job, take the time to correctly prepare the surface area prior to diving into the fun part of using the paint.



Beginning by completely cleansing the surface area to eliminate any type of dirt, dirt, grease, or mildew. Fining sand the surface smooth can help develop a far better bond for the paint to adhere to. Load any type of openings or fractures with spackling compound and sand them down once dry.

It's also vital to prime the surface before painting to guarantee much better insurance coverage and sturdiness.

Disregarding proper surface area preparation can cause a poor coating that might need pricey touch-ups and even a full redo. By investing effort and time into preparing the surface area properly, you can achieve professional-looking results that will stand the test of time.

Neglecting Proper Clean-up



Falling short to properly clean up after completing a painting task can bring about a selection of problems that can have been conveniently stayed clear of. Overlooking correct clean-up can lead to dried out paint on brushes, rollers, and trays, making them difficult or impossible to reuse. Leaving paint canisters open or incorrectly sealed can result in premature drying out of the paint within, wasting your sources. Additionally, not cleaning spills or splatters without delay can cause stains on floors, furniture, or other surfaces that might be challenging to get rid of later.

To avoid these troubles, see to it to cleanse your painting devices thoroughly after each use. Use suitable cleaner for the sort of paint you used and comply with the manufacturer's instructions. Seal paint cans firmly to avoid drying out and store them in a trendy, completely dry place. Address spills quickly with a damp fabric or sponge to avoid them from setting.

Proper clean-up not just maintains the high quality of your devices and products but likewise makes certain a clean and organized office for your following paint project.
